South Korean virtual K-pop star Apoki teams up with Charles and Keith

Who better than a virtual K-pop artist to embody the foray of a brand of Singaporean fashion in the world?

This appears to be why Charles and Keith enlisted South Korean virtual musician "Apoki" as collaborator and interpreter. The pastel-loving avatar recently released her first single of 2023, "Mood V5".

Apoki is meant to recall "a rabbit-like being living somewhere in outer space". Now imagine someone who is into K-pop and dance who likes to flaunt fashion trends. The virtual artist has over 4.8 million social media followers.

For its new platform on The Sandbox and tapping into its spring campaign, Charles & Keith leveraged virtual K-pop artist to host a rooftop party and perform some of her singles - digitally dressed in looks from the global accessories brand's new collection. From Monday to March 27, the Charleskeithhaus will be live on the virtual real estate platform The Sandbox. Inspired by the brand's "State of Play" spring campaign, the immersive Charleskeithhaus incorporates highlights from the collection, including its color palette, into every detail of the virtual home. There will also be an NFT gallery showcasing newly released artwork to encourage experimentation and attract fashion fans.

The digital experience will include quizzes, parkour challenges and the location of a secret room to swap a digital wearable for this the brand's must-have bag of the season, the Petra Curved shoulder bag. The actual version sells for $63 on the company's e-commerce site.

Some Apoki fans were drawn to the virtual artist's music videos, known for their visuals more attractive synthesis. Its just-released music video also features the prototype of the new brand AFEELA, which was announced by Sony Honda Mobility Inc. at CES in January. Apoki has been selected to perform as a pioneer in the realm of virtual K-pop artists in honor of the brand's new expansion into the virtual world.

In 1996, Charles & Keith co-founders Charles and Keith Wong started the company in emphasizing fashion and versatility. footwear for progressive city dwellers. Since then, they have expanded this category and added handbags, eyewear, accessories and fashion jewelry to their assortment.
